Team — quick update for all heads of department. We have opened preliminary talks to acquire Larkspire Metrics, the analytics firm based in Corven Bay. Diligence starts Thursday; Priya Oventhal leads. Do not discuss outside this group. Expect data requests from your functions within the week; turn them around fast. Board review is set for month-end, and funding structure is still open. The strategic rationale and terms are summarised in the confidential note below.

internal memo for kawip-hadug: Headcount on the Wenwyn team goes from 7 to 140 by the end of January. Gross margin on Wenwyn came in at 20 percent against a plan of 15 percent.

Runbook bit for the Mallowtide bounce processor release. Hey, welcome aboard! Short version: merge to main, let CI build the bouncer image, then push it through the staging queue for an hour to watch hard-bounce rates. Production pushes must be signed or the deployer bails. Sign the release with the key below.

rollout seal: bky19_BLvzNywFPc4Kk7gKMSj

The cut-over of the Mirelock validator plugin system finished at 02:40 without rollback. All seventeen validators now load through the new registry rather than the hardcoded manifest, and each plugin runs in its own worker with an enforced timeout. Two plugins (postal-format and currency-range) needed version bumps to satisfy the new interface; both passed replay tests against last week's traffic. If a validator misbehaves tonight, disable it via the registry rather than redeploying. The settings now live in production are listed below.

service settings:
PRAIX_LOG_LEVEL=error
PRAIX_METRICS_HOST=metrics.praix.qorvelcorp.corp
PRAIX_POOL_SIZE=16

## 2.9.0 — Changed defaults

The Dawnrow backfill scheduler now defaults to staggered nightly runs instead of a single 01:00 batch. Jobs are spread across a four-hour window to reduce warehouse contention. Retries drop from five to three, with exponential backoff. Customers with pinned schedules are unaffected. If a backfill appears missing, check the new window before reopening tickets. New default configuration follows.

settings of tagef-bawif:
DRUIX_HOST=druix.zemvarlabs.internal
DRUIX_PORT=8000